Man arrested on suspicion of wounding a pensioner in Solihull

A MAN has been arrested on suspicion of wounding a pensioner in Solihull.

The alleged attack took place on Thursday evening (May 10) outside Touchwood shopping centre on Poplar Road.

A 70-year-old man sustained a head injury following an altercation and was taken to Heartlands Hospital for treatment.

A West Midlands Police spokesperson said: “Police were called to Poplar Road, Solihull, following a reported altercation by the bus stop at around 5.30pm last night (Thursday, May 10).




“A 70-year-old man has been taken to hospital with a head injury.

“A 24-year-old man has been arrested on suspicion of wounding and has been released under investigation while enquiries continue.


“Anyone with information is asked to call detective constable Adam Buzzard at Solihull Police on 101; quoting crime reference number 20SH/103701F/18.”

A West Midlands Ambulance service spokeswoman added: “We were called just before 6pm. One ambulance attended and we treated an elderly man who suffered a cut to his head.

“He was taken to Heartlands Hospital for further treatment.”
